package org.apache.synapse.startup.tasks;
import org.apache.axiom.om.OMAbstractFactory;
import org.apache.axiom.om.OMElement;
import org.apache.axis2.AxisFault;
import org.apache.axis2.addressing.EndpointReference;
import org.apache.commons.logging.Log;
import org.apache.commons.logging.LogFactory;
import org.apache.synapse.ManagedLifecycle;
import org.apache.synapse.MessageContext;
import org.apache.synapse.SynapseException;
import org.apache.synapse.core.SynapseEnvironment;
import org.apache.synapse.mediators.MediatorFaultHandler;
import org.apache.synapse.task.Task;
import org.apache.synapse.util.PayloadHelper;
/**
* Injects a Message in to the Synapse environment
*/
public class MessageInjector implements Task, ManagedLifecycle {
/**
* Holds the logger for logging purposes
*/
private Log log = LogFactory.getLog(MessageInjector.class);
/**
* Holds the Message to be injected
*/
private OMElement message = null;
/**
* Holds the to address for the message to be injected
*/
private String to = null;
/**
* Could be one of either "soap11" | "soap12" | "pox" | "get"
*/
private String format = null;
/**
* SOAPAction of the message to be set, in case of the format is soap11
*/
private String soapAction = null;
/**
* Holds the SynapseEnv to which the message will be injected
*/
private SynapseEnvironment synapseEnvironment;
public final static String SOAP11_FORMAT = "soap11";
public final static String SOAP12_FORMAT = "soap12";
public final static String POX_FORMAT = "pox";
public final static String GET_FORMAT = "get";
/**
* Initializes the Injector
*
* @param se
* SynapseEnvironment of synapse
*/
public void init(SynapseEnvironment se) {
synapseEnvironment = se;
}
/**
* Set the message to be injected
*
* @param elem
* OMElement describing the message
*/
public void setMessage(OMElement elem) {
log.debug("set message " + elem.toString());
message = elem;
}
/**
* Set the to address of the message to be injected
*
* @param url
* String containing the to address
*/
public void setTo(String url) {
to = url;
}
/**
* Sets the format of the message
*
* @param format could be one of either "soap11" | "soap12" | "pox" | "get"
*/
public void setFormat(String format) {
this.format = format;
}
/**
* Sets the SOAPAction and valid only when the format is given as soap11
*
* @param soapAction SOAPAction header value to be set
*/
public void setSoapAction(String soapAction) {
this.soapAction = soapAction;
}
/**
* This will be invoked by the schedular to inject the message
* in to the SynapseEnvironment
*/
public void execute() {
log.debug("execute");
if (synapseEnvironment == null) {
log.error("Synapse Environment not set");
return;
}
if (message == null) {
log.error("message not set");
return;
}
if (to == null) {
log.error("to address not set");
return;
}
MessageContext mc = synapseEnvironment.createMessageContext();
// AspectHelper.setGlobalAudit(mc); TODO
mc.pushFaultHandler(new MediatorFaultHandler(mc.getFaultSequence()));
mc.setTo(new EndpointReference(to));
if (format == null) {
PayloadHelper.setXMLPayload(mc, message.cloneOMElement());
} else {
try {
if (SOAP11_FORMAT.equalsIgnoreCase(format)) {
mc.setEnvelope(OMAbstractFactory.getSOAP11Factory().createSOAPEnvelope());
} else if (SOAP12_FORMAT.equalsIgnoreCase(format)) {
mc.setEnvelope(OMAbstractFactory.getSOAP12Factory().createSOAPEnvelope());
} else if (POX_FORMAT.equalsIgnoreCase(format)) {
mc.setDoingPOX(true);
} else if (GET_FORMAT.equalsIgnoreCase(format)) {
mc.setDoingGET(true);
}
PayloadHelper.setXMLPayload(mc, message.cloneOMElement());
} catch (AxisFault axisFault) {
String msg = "Error in setting the message payload : " + message;
log.error(msg, axisFault);
throw new SynapseException(msg, axisFault);
}
}
if (soapAction != null) {
mc.setSoapAction(soapAction);
}
synapseEnvironment.injectMessage(mc);
}
/**
* Destroys the Injector
*/
public void destroy() {
}
}
